Output 824cc21d90a221aa9d20fc78f4e9be87e8ee1817f59213eb5379fadca83bd55c:4

value
571040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868c6f791c93c16fb963664b9ac536dc7e0e7cfc OP_EQUAL
address
3DxShsgN1bRm2bKvykAaZFpA5QGZpwfPrY
transaction
824cc21d90a221aa9d20fc78f4e9be87e8ee1817f59213eb5379fadca83bd55c
spent
true